Leslie Gentile
Leslie Gentile’s debut novel, Elvis, Me, and the Lemonade Stand Summer (2021), won the City of Victoria Children’s Book Prize, the Jean Little First-Novel Award, and has been short-listed for ten other awards. Leslie is also a singer/songwriter and performs with two of her adult children in The Leslie Gentile Band. Leslie lives on Vancouver Island on the traditional territory of the W-SÁNEĆ people with her husband and a German shepherd who is convinced that he’s a lapdog. Though not connected with a specific nation, Leslie is of Indigenous and settler heritage, and has Salish, Tuscarora, and Scottish ancestry.
